Double pane windows consist of two glass layers with an insulating gas, like argon or krypton, trapped between them. This design minimizes heat transfer, keeping your home warmer in winter and cooler in summer. The dense gases significantly improve thermal efficiency, which results in a more comfortable living environment and reduces reliance on heating and cooling systems.
Upgrading from single-pane to double pane windows can save you between $126 and $465 annually on energy costs, according to the U.S. Department of Energy. These savings stem from the enhanced insulation properties that reduce heating and cooling needs. Low-E (Low Emissivity) coatings significantly improve energy efficiency in double pane windows. These thin, transparent layers are applied to the glass surfaces. They reflect heat back into your home during winter while keeping it cool in summer. This dual functionality reduces energy costs by minimizing reliance on heating and cooling systems. The application of Low-E coatings can enhance comfort levels by controlling the interior temperature, making them a valuable feature for homeowners.
Gas fills refer to the inert gases, such as argon or krypton, that occupy the space between the two glass panes. These gases offer better insulation than air, further reducing heat transfer and enhancing thermal performance. Homes with gas-filled double pane windows can experience improved energy efficiency, leading to cost savings on heating and cooling. The use of gas fills contributes to a more stable indoor climate by minimizing drafts and fluctuations in temperature, making your living space more comfortable year-round.

Double pane windows consist of two glass layers separated by a spacer filled with insulating gas, like argon or krypton. They provide better insulation than single-pane windows, helping to maintain a comfortable indoor temperature and reduce energy costs.
Double pane windows reduce heat transfer, leading to lower energy consumption. Their insulating properties can save homeowners between $126 and $465 annually on energy bills, according to the U.S. Department of Energy.
Benefits include improved energy efficiency, enhanced indoor comfort, better soundproofing, UV protection for furnishings, and increased property value, making them a smart investment for homeowners.
The initial investment for double pane windows typically ranges from $300 to $1,000 per window. While the upfront cost may be higher than single-pane options, the energy savings can make them more economical over time.
Yes, you can opt for DIY installation if you have the right tools and skills. The process involves careful measurements, removing old windows, and ensuring a proper fit for the new windows. However, professional installation ensures accuracy and quality.
Maintenance includes regular cleaning, checking for fogging between panes, and inspecting frames for damage. Use suitable cleaning solutions and techniques to keep the windows looking great and performing efficiently.
Low-E (low-emissivity) coating is a special layer on the glass that reflects heat. In winter, it keeps heat inside, while in summer, it reflects heat away, improving energy efficiency and comfort throughout the year.
